Abstract
A base member includes a first end to be mounted to a bicycle handlebar and a second end opposite to the first end. An operating member is pivotally coupled to the base member about a first pivot axis. A hydraulic unit is coupled to the operating member to operate a bicycle component in response to an operation of the operating member. At least part of the hydraulic unit is disposed closer to the first end than the first pivot axis when viewed from a first direction parallel to the first pivot axis. A wireless communicator is to wirelessly transmit a signal to an additional component in response to the input operation. A power supply is electrically connected to the wireless communicator. At least one of the wireless communicator and the power supply is disposed closer to the second end than the first pivot axis when viewed from the first direction.
